A simple, vibrant, and delicious treat for a holiday or just to lift the spirits. These candies can be topped with a variety of toppings, so the chances of not finding a favorite combination are minimal. Even without the toppings, the truffles are still quite tasty, though perhaps not as vibrant.



The recipes use measuring containers with the following volumes:
1 glass (st.) - 250 ml.
3/4 cup (st.) - 180 ml.
2/3 cup (st.) - 160 ml.
1/2 cup (st.) - 125 ml.
1/3 cup (st.) - 80 ml.
1/4 cup (st.) - 60 ml.
1 tablespoon (tbsp) - 15 ml.
1 teaspoon (tsp) - 5 ml.
1/5 teaspoon (tsp) - 1 ml.

Cooking the dish according to the recipe:


  1. Using a mixer, beat the powdered sugar, peanut butter, melted butter, vanilla extract, and salt until smooth. Roll portions of the mixture (1 heaping teaspoon) into balls and place on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
  2. Roll the peanut butter balls in any or all of the toppings. Freeze until firm, about 20 minutes. These truffles are best served very chilled.
